From dd5ecb2a5c624c46a6e5629f674ae62dfbf10b14 Mon Sep 17 00:00:00 2001 From: Wei Yongjun Date: Tue, 26 Mar 2013 04:45:11 -0300 Subject: [PATCH] --- yaml --- r: 366875 b: refs/heads/master c: 02745f63443c08b9b82ab2d654a0f5fc3699e586 h: refs/heads/master i: 366873: febf165d4826772a884adb68d2ae532483d01038 366871: 05823746d420027469c5a33fae6ec2fad8f915ae v: v3 --- [refs] | 2 +- trunk/drivers/staging/media/go7007/go7007-usb.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/[refs] b/[refs] index 2f824c702a14..25f27655bf0d 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 0170a39b69ae65fffb40bd162730e3de2b87c835 +refs/heads/master: 02745f63443c08b9b82ab2d654a0f5fc3699e586 diff --git a/trunk/drivers/staging/media/go7007/go7007-usb.c b/trunk/drivers/staging/media/go7007/go7007-usb.c index a734ead8fc64..50066e01a6ed 100644 --- a/trunk/drivers/staging/media/go7007/go7007-usb.c +++ b/trunk/drivers/staging/media/go7007/go7007-usb.c @@ -1037,7 +1037,7 @@ static int go7007_usb_i2c_master_xfer(struct i2c_adapter *adapter, buf, buf_len, 0) < 0) goto i2c_done; if (msgs[i].flags & I2C_M_RD) { - memset(buf, 0, sizeof(buf)); + memset(buf, 0, msgs[i].len + 1); if (go7007_usb_vendor_request(go, 0x25, 0, 0, buf, msgs[i].len + 1, 1) < 0) goto i2c_done;